Want to cover your floors with outlines of feet? Well, you can get it with Bentley Prince Street's ViVA L.A.'s "Feet on the Street" product. It was designed in collaboration with L.A. based pop artist Andre Miripolsky who created a large 3-D wall sculpture of his vision of downtown L.A.'s exploding skyline. Sure it's fun and different, but it's definitely a carpet design I wouldn't recommend... not even for podiatrists, or kids areas... too corny for me! There is also a pattern in the collection with arrows all over it called " Which Way Now" and one that I would consider using.... "Linked to the Vibe" because it's an interesting pattern without being an exact representation of something (of anything that I can tell at least!).
